Transitional Duty
Frequently, when an employee returns to work with medical restrictions they are assigned menial tasks that are unrelated to their job. Returning employees, often, feel like outsiders at their own job during this process. Customized Transitional Duty programs can keep employees productive and safe, while limiting feelings of isolation during the return-to-work process.
